Earth tremor hits parts of Accra

An earth tremor hit parts of Accra on Sunday, November 12, 2023, around 7:20 am.

The tremor, which lasted for a few seconds, sent residents into a panic, with many running out of their homes around Weija, a suburb of Accra.

Residents around Mallam, Gbawe, SCC and Bortianor also reported experiencing the Earth tremor Sunday morning.

There are no reports of any injuries or damage to property. However, several people who experienced the earth tremor took to social media page X formerly Twitter to share their experience

On March 10, this year, parts of Accra also experienced a minor earth tremor, which the Ghana Geological Survey Authority put the magnitude at 2.8 on the Richter scale.

Similarly, December 12, 2022, parts of Accra also experienced tremors which occurred three times in a space of about five hours.

The first was experienced around 6:53 am, also in the western part of Accra, the second around 10 am at the same places and the third occurred at 11:53 am, 10 km from Gbawe.
